Ok so I got another car now this one is up for sale! One of my favorite movies of all time is The Good, The Bad, and The Ugly. So here it goes. The Good: Car starts up right, heat blows hot A/C blows cold. Wipers work all turn signals work, sunroof works. The car has new front brake pads and a new drivers side axle. The tires are pretty new also. It rides great on the highway with plenty of power and the trans shifts well. This car spent its life in FL so it is RUST FREE!!! That means the brake lines and undercarriage aren't all rusted out like if the car was from New England. The car also gets good gas mileage for the power it has. The main relay was just replaced on this. If you are familar with Hondas or Acuras you know this part can cause very hard to diagnose problems. The Bad: It leaks oil causing the car to smoke from the engine compartment. It's either leaking from the valve covers or the oil pan. I will include a pair of valve cover gaskets. The trunk latch is broken so the trunk is held down with bungee cords. Also the drivers side rear door has no outside handle. The widow motor is also broken on that door so the window is taped up with black duct tape. The odometer stopped working about 1000 miles ago the title says 134000 when I registered it 6 months ago and it stopped working around 145000. The check engine light is on also because of the EGR valve. The Ugly: The clear coat is peeling all over the car. There is a dent in the trunk lid and the plastic skid pan under the front of the car is hanging. This car can be driven right as it sits just keep an eye on the oil. I don't have the time to give it the TLC it needs to be a great car.
